Coffee Chats for Dating After Rejection: Flirting With Care in Oldfield, Maryland

When someone wants to stay open after a disappointing match, a coffee chat focused on careful flirting in Oldfield, Maryland can make the next step feel more manageable. Warm flirting should make the date feel lighter, not more pressured. After rejection, a simple next date can help someone stay open without forcing optimism.

  1. Shape the plan: Choose a casual coffee or tea setting where the date can stay short, public, and conversation-focused.
  2. Protect comfort: Use sincere compliments, gentle humor, and small observations that leave room for the other person to respond comfortably.
  3. Use the chat well: Focus on learning how the person communicates rather than proving the date must become something.
  4. Know what to avoid: Avoid sexual pressure, overconfident promises, or teasing that could be read as careless.

If trust is still forming, choose a public plan that makes boundaries easy to discuss. A date in Oldfield, Maryland does not need to answer everything at once. It only needs to help two people notice whether comfort, curiosity, and communication are moving in the same direction.

Dating Confidence Reset

Start by naming what you want from Mingle2 right now—casual conversation, new friends, or something long-term. Being clear about your own intent makes it easier to recognize good matches and to say no to connections that aren't aligned.

Set Realistic Expectations

Expect ups and downs. Not every message will lead somewhere, and that’s normal. Treat each interaction as information: what you learn about other people helps you refine what matters to you.

Slow The Pace, Keep The Momentum

  • Lead with curiosity instead of urgency. Ask a few thoughtful questions before escalating to a phone call or date.
  • Match the other person’s pace. If they respond slowly, mirror that rhythm for a while instead of over-texting.
  • Limit app time daily so dating stays part of your life, not your whole life.

Protect Your Emotional Energy

Keep boundaries that feel doable: a limit on nightly swiping, a short list of deal-breakers, and a mental rule for when to step back after a disappointing conversation. Rejection feels personal, but it’s often about fit, not your worth.

Notice Small Wins

Track progress beyond dates—clearer profile photos, a bio tweak that gets better replies, a conversation that lasted longer than usual. Those are signs you’re learning and improving.

Choose Matches Thoughtfully

  1. Use your profile and messages to test basic compatibility (values, lifestyle, red flags).
  2. Prioritize quality over quantity: a few thoughtful chats are more useful than many shallow ones.
  3. Unmatch or pause conversations that drain you without guilt—preserve time for people who add energy.

These small, practical shifts help you stay measured and self-respecting while using Mingle2. Confidence in dating grows from clarity, steady pacing, and protecting your own time and feelings—one intentional step at a time.
